An Intimate Retreat in Upstate New York
According to Anderson, the relationship blossomed during an “intimate week” spent at Neeson’s home in upstate New York. ”If you must know, Liam and I were romantically involved for a short while but only after we finished filming,” she shared. The connection wasn’t just fleeting; Neeson reportedly introduced Anderson to friends as “the future Mrs. Neeson” during a dinner at a French restaurant.
The actress fondly recalled shared moments of domesticity, including tending to Neeson’s garden. “I tended to a rosebush overgrown with mint… I was happy to help, and he appreciated,” she said, painting a picture of a surprisingly grounded connection amidst their celebrity status.
Adding a touch of the unexpected, Anderson recounted a memorable incident where Neeson bravely chased a bear away from the window while in his bathrobe during breakfast. This anecdote, dubbed a “lost week” by Anderson, highlights the unique and somewhat surreal nature of their brief romance.
From Romance to Friendship: A Mature Understanding
The relationship, though, was not destined to last. “We went our separate ways to work on other films,” Anderson explained, acknowledging the demands of their respective careers.
